No. 23 Davidson is Dancing

Wildcats win Southern Conference, earn 3rd straight NCAA trip

Share

(Newser) – The No. 23 Davidson Wildcats defeated Elon to win their third consecutive Southern Conference title and advance to the NCAA Tournament. The Wildcats' standard-bearer, as usual, by conference player of the year Stephen Curry; the sophomore had 23 points, including five 3-pointers, to lead the team. T.J. Douglas led the Phoenix with 18 points on six 3-pointers, reports the Associated Press.

The victory gave Davidson 22 consecutive wins, which is the longest current streak in the country. It also extended the Wildcats’ conference winning streak to 36 games. Elon entered the tournament as the seventh seed after finishing the regular season with an 11-18 record. The Phoenix toppled conference powers Chattanooga and College of Charleston to reach the tournament final.
